About This Book

The Schopenhauer Cure by Irvin D. Yalom blends psychotherapy, philosophy, and fiction in a compelling exploration of mortality and personal transformation. When therapist Julius Hertzfeld confronts a terminal diagnosis, he reconnects with a former patient who claims to have overcome addiction through Schopenhauer’s philosophy. Through intense group therapy sessions, the novel examines death, meaning, human connection, and the tension between philosophical detachment and emotional engagement.
